#349c9f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#349c9f is composed of 20.4% red, 61.2%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.3% cyan, 1.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 181.7 degrees, a saturation of 50.7% and a lightness of 41.4%. #349c9f color hex could be obtained by blending #68ffff with #00393f.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#349c9f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040b0b is the darkest color, while #fbf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#349c9f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656e6e is the less saturated color, while #03cad0 is the most saturated one.
